Ticket: Staging env misconfigured for Siftgate bloom filter

The bloom layer in front of the Pellet KV store is rejecting all lookups in staging because the env file was copied from the dev template without credentials. False-positive tuning values are fine; only the auth line is missing. To unblock the weekly demo, the Pellet admission secret must be set on the following line.

env line for yaguf-fajop: LEDGER_TOKEN13=fb08984397349

After review, leadership has approved expanding the Thornquist Works facility rather than commissioning a second site near Dunmarsh. The expansion adds two production lines over three quarters. Branch order allocations will be constrained during the retooling window; plan inventory accordingly and flag large commitments to regional planning before confirming them with customers. Standard lead times resume once line two is live. A confidential planning note follows for your awareness.

confidential, fahip-bagep: The southern region missed its Holwyn quota by 21.5 percent last quarter. Sorvanek Foods plans to raise the Jorir list price by 23.9 percent in December. The pricing group signed off on a budget of $411.6 million for Project Eliion. The renewal with Juldorix Works closes at $87.9 million a year, 16.8 percent below the last contract.

## Step 4: Wire up your renderer plugin

Once your plugin passes the Quillmark sandbox checks, you're ready to hook it into the rendering pipeline. Quillmark streams each markdown document through your transform before sanitization, so keep it fast — anything over 50ms gets dropped from the hot path. Create a `.env` file in your plugin root with your usual settings. Add the signing secret Quillmark issued to your plugin on the next line.

sealed setting: RELAY_SECRET5=82864

A: Latticework returns an empty grid when the word pool cannot satisfy the symmetry constraints within the solver's time budget. This is expected behavior, not an error, so your plugin should handle it gracefully rather than retrying immediately. Common causes include overly restrictive theme word lists or custom blocked-cell patterns. To debug, enable verbose solver tracing and compare against the reference constraint set documented on our internal page below.

operations page: https://jenkins.zemvarcloud.local/job/merge_requests/repo/build/73930b4b30f0a8ed